Elita and Jack ran right into the classroom right when the bell rang. They were both panting as they sat down in the last two empty seats in the room.

The teacher, Mr. Ception had his back turned as he wrote on the blackboard. He had red salt and pepper hair and wore blue jeans with a red dress shirt.

"Miss Twon. Late on your first day I see." He spoke.

"Sorry sir. Your class moved. I had to figure out where it was." Elita replied.

Mr. Ception turned around and looked at Jack. He saw that the teacher wore a monocle. "And you must be Jackson Darby."

Jack nodded. "Just Jack is fine sir."

Mr. Ception tapped his leg. "This is the first day and I hardly expect you to know where your class is. However, now that you do, I will not tolerate anymore tardiness. Am I clear?"

Elita and Jack nodded at the teacher and sunk back into their chairs.

Mr. Ception finished writing on the blackboard. It was his name and the title of Basics of Linguistics.

"Welcome to Cybertron Academy. If you hadn't already guessed that I am going to be your homeroom teacher for this semester, then get out now. You clearly don't belong here." Mr. Ception began.

He waited for a few seconds but no one moved. He nodded.

"Good. Now, this semester you will learn the very basics of our school's linguistics curriculum—"

Mr. Ception continued to talk about what they were going to be learning during the semester. Forming proper sentences. Essays. Phonetics. Everything Jack was a pro at.

He finished talking almost twenty minutes before the class was over. He let his new students chat amongst themselves.

Jack turned to Elita. He looked at her. She looked a few years older than him.

"Um, Elita. What are you doing in the freshman's linguistics class?" Jack asked.

Elita's face turned red and she smiled awkwardly. "Well, let's just say that I most certainly didn't get accepted into the academy because of my incredible reading and writing skills. I've been held back in this class for almost two years now."

Elita sighed as she looked down at the book Mr. Ception had handed out. She opened it up to the first page and stared at the words on the paper.

"It all looks like freaking chicken scratch. The letters look all jumbled up and then they start flying off the page in disorderly patterns." Elita complained. "I used to be...visually impaired and never needed to read. However now that I have sight, I can't read because I never learned how."

Jack looked at her worriedly. "Then how do you get by in other subjects?"

"Well, my best friend is in all my other classes. She reads the word questions to me. But it would be nice to pass this class this year. I just need one more language credit to graduate." Elita replied.

She put her head down against the book.

"Until then, I'm just gonna have to suck it up and suffer through it and hopefully not fail this year." Elita concluded. "So Jack. Have you decided whether or not you're going to join a faction?"

Jack shrugged. "I'm thinking of joining the Autobots right now."

Elita smiled at him. "Hashtag Autobots am I right?"

Jack smiled. "The Autobots seem trustworthy."

Elita got up and nodded. "We are. Don't worry, you seem trustworthy too. If you want I can put in a good word for you."

"Can you?" Jack wondered.

"Sure! I'm a senior Autobot. I'll get you in no problem." Elita assured him.

"Oh. Thanks." Jack replied.

Elita nodded and took out her phone. There was a text on the lock screen. She smiled and swiped it open so she could text back.

When she sent it she sighed happily. "He should really stop trying to be romantic. He sucks at it."

Jack looked at her.

"Oh. My boyfriend. He's trying to act like a womanizer over a text. Unfortunately for him he just comes off as awkward. It's high–larious." She explained.

Jack couldn't help but laugh too.


They sat there and chatted until the bell rang.

When it did, all of the other students got up and walked out of the classroom.

"Well, I'm off to my Advanced Mathematics class." Elita announced.

"Advanced Mathematics? You can't get by in linguistics but you're in the Advanced Mathematics course?" Jack said incredulously.

Elita shrugged. "Numbers not letters Jack."

"But there are letters in math."

"Those are variables. Totally different! See you when I see you Jack!" Elita replied as she ran off in the opposite direction.

Jack watched her go before turning to go to his next class. Science. Great.

The class was on the second floor. He sighed as he walked up the crowded stairway. He walked through the hall and met up with Miko and Raf who were apparently in his class as well.

"So. Science. It ain't my best subject. How about you guys?" Miko said.

"I passed science last year. It's okay. Not my favourite but okay. Raf?" Jack replied.

"I've been getting straight A's in the past few years. My parents expect me to keep it up." Raf answered.

"Uh huh." Jack said. "So how were your homerooms?"

"I liked it. Our teacher, he said his name was Terry Traant, was really cool. He sounded a little robotic but he made the computer sound really awesome." Raf spoke.

"My teacher was alright. Mr. Harmone. He was nothing outstanding but he wasn't terrible." Miko replied.

"My teacher, Mr. Ception seemed really strict." Jack said. "He didn't seem bad though. Plus, I met another Autobot in that class."

"Really? Who?" Miko asked.

"Her name is Ellen Twon. Her Autobots name is Elita One." Jack answered. "She said that she could probably get me into the Autobot faction."

"Seriously? Can you ask her to get me in to? I so wanna join their faction. It seems awesome!" Miko exclaimed.

Jack shrugged. "Maybe."

Their science teacher was Ms. Beta. She seemed nice but strict, similar to Mr. Ception.

She didn't talk for too long, and let the students socialize until the bell rang for lunch.

Jack, Miko and Raf were walking down the stairs towards the cafeteria as they were met by their guides.

"Hey guys!" Bulkhead called. "You guys going for lunch?"

Miko nodded.

"Cool! We'll come with! We'll introduce you to some other Autobots." Bulkhead replied.

"Sweet!" Miko exclaimed.
